Unit of Study: AHCD5052 - Indigenous Community Health

This unit of study provides an introduction to the conceptual underpinning of Indigenous community as an area of academic study and professional practice. The multi-disciplinary, problem orientated and participatory nature of community health will be explored in relation to the unique context of Indigenous health. Student will also analyse the meaning and causation of disease and the organisational structures and management of community health through case studies in a variety of Indigenous settings.

Unit coordinator: Dr Freidoon Khavarpour

Classes: External/distance mode

Assessment: 2000 word focus questions, 2000 word review of a health care setting, developing an action plan, 2500 words
